Abstract
The present application relates to a valve for a cryogenic gas. The valve includes a body with a main inlet, a main outlet, and a main passage. The valve also includes a main shutter for the main passage, the main shutter including an auxiliary inlet, an auxiliary outlet, and an auxiliary passage, in which an auxiliary shutter is arranged, which includes a closing surface configured to close the auxiliary outlet and be able to drive the main shutter in the closing direction, and a drive surface configured to drive the main shutter in the opening direction, while resting on the edge of the auxiliary inlet and blocking the auxiliary inlet partially in order to brake the flow there. The drive surface is formed by drive lugs which are connected to a head of the auxiliary shutter. The lugs form a bayonet coupling between the shutters. The present application also relates to an electrovalve.
